aboutsummaryrefslogtreecommitdiff
path: root/src/validation.h
diff options
context:
space:
mode:
authorAlex Morcos <morcos@chaincode.com>2016-11-11 13:29:13 -0500
committerAlex Morcos <morcos@chaincode.com>2017-01-04 12:10:17 -0500
commitdc008c462f6df84dd444c9646f7ca64ee1c8c841 (patch)
treed9ad056188457ee015bba64c346b01cd2b358b4f /src/validation.h
parentebafdcabb10a89b491cdb8430bc43b0220d436df (diff)
downloadbitcoin-dc008c462f6df84dd444c9646f7ca64ee1c8c841.tar.xz
Add IsCurrentForFeeEstimatation
Make a more conservative notion of whether the node is caught up to the rest of the network and only count transactions as fee estimation data points if the node is caught up.
Diffstat (limited to 'src/validation.h')
-rw-r--r--src/validation.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/validation.h b/src/validation.h
index 981f659633..0f421d59e7 100644
--- a/src/validation.h
+++ b/src/validation.h
@@ -130,6 +130,8 @@ static const int64_t BLOCK_DOWNLOAD_TIMEOUT_PER_PEER = 500000;
static const unsigned int DEFAULT_LIMITFREERELAY = 0;
static const bool DEFAULT_RELAYPRIORITY = true;
static const int64_t DEFAULT_MAX_TIP_AGE = 24 * 60 * 60;
+/** Maximum age of our tip for us to be considered current for fee estimation */
+static const int64_t MAX_FEE_ESTIMATION_TIP_AGE = 3 * 60 * 60;
/** Default for -permitbaremultisig */
static const bool DEFAULT_PERMIT_BAREMULTISIG = true;